How We Calculate Calories Burned for Lunges in Las Vegas
Our calculator uses the standard MET (Metabolic Equivalent of Task) formula with a local climate adjustment for Las Vegas:
Calories = MET × Weight (kg) × Duration (hrs) × Climate Factor
= 5 × Weight (kg) × Duration (hrs) × 1.00
The MET value of 5 for lunges is sourced from the Compendium of Physical Activities. The climate factor of 1.00 accounts for Las Vegas's average temperature of 68°F. Research shows that exercising in non-neutral temperatures increases energy expenditure as the body works to maintain its core temperature.
Lunges are a fundamental lower body exercise where you step forward, backward, or sideways and lower your hips until both knees are bent at approximately 90 degrees. This unilateral movement builds strength and balance while correcting muscle imbalances between legs. Walking lunges add a cardiovascular element and increase calorie burn beyond stationary variations. Lunges are essential for developing functional leg strength used in everyday activities like climbing stairs and bending down.
